Hello,

I’m Jose Blanco, Jose as most people call me.

I was born in Ourense, on June 15, 1976, and I grew up in my homeland, Galicia.

When I was 17 years old, I participated in the creation of my first association, linked to the world of new technologies, and I loved the experience.

My academic training has been mainly humanistic, but I have continued learning through specialized courses in a wide variety of fields, from photography, IT, people management, business management, communication and marketing, … and also association management, of course.

Over the years I have continued to be involved with the associative world, in many ways, until 2006, when I decided to create Rabuso, specifically to start managing a newly established association.

My professional experience includes multiple fields of communication, marketing, events and editorial, with special emphasis on institutional work in several European countries and in Brussels before the European Union.

I am the father of two children, who are nowadays my main attention when I am not working.

In addition, I love motorcycles and in general anything with an engine, screws or that can be disassembled.

I am also a friend of a good debate, sharing business management dynamics or any topic related to the areas of communication and marketing.

In the company, my main role is to take care of everything related to the governance and strategy of the associations, supporting the rest of my colleagues in our team.

Until COVID arrived, I spent almost every week traveling around Spain and Europe, but this new reality is helping me to do things differently.
